Webbcopy their rhythm onto the staff, as notes of the C Major scale; the C Major scale is eight notes in alphabetical order from middle C to the next C. start and end on any C. Notes can be used in any order or repeated. try and move in steps (pitches close together) rather than leaps (pitches far apart), as this will sound nicer. WebbA chord tone is a note that is in the chord, and a non-chord tone is a note that is not in the chord but still in the scale. Chord tones will sound comfortable and satisfying, while non-chord tones will add tension and excitement. Another way to think about this is chord tones are stable while non-chord tones are unstable. Webb25 maj 2024 · In polyphony, the pitches and rhythms of each musical part are different from one another, yet they are sung or played at the same time. Think of a round, like 'Row, Row, Row Your Boat'.
